Job Description

The role involves managing and improving the performance, reliability, and evolution of Alarm.com's real-time video streaming infrastructure, working closely with engineering teams to optimize streaming quality, protocols, cloud costs, and integrations in a technically deep product management capacity.

Key Responsibilities

  • Own and improve the performance, reliability, and evolution of the video streaming infrastructure.
  • Define streaming quality targets and track metrics such as connection success rates, load times, and cloud costs.
  • Analyze session logs, codecs, and benchmarking data to identify issues and prioritize improvements.
  • Own the product roadmap for streaming protocols, proxy infrastructure, adaptive bitrate streaming, and codec modernization.
  • Collaborate with engineering teams on cloud infrastructure, cost optimization, and migration initiatives.
  • Lead third-party video integrations and manage vendor relationships.
  • Coordinate firmware updates across device fleets to ensure safe and timely rollouts.
  • Manage dependencies, risks, and communication across multiple engineering teams for cross-team programs.

Requirements

  • Have real technical depth in video or media systems, including the ability to explain how a WebRTC session is established, what a TURN relay does, why transcoding is expensive, or how an SDP offer answer exchange works.
  • Experience working with streaming protocols, codecs, or media pipelines, whether as an engineer or as a product manager who has gone deep into technical details.
  • Possess data-driven decision-making skills, including building or owning performance dashboards and making product decisions based on p50 p95 latency data, error rates, and cost-per-stream.
  • Ability to read code and architecture diagrams, including understanding system design documents, following code reviews, or reading log files to troubleshoot issues.
  • Experience managing complex, cross-functional programs involving multiple teams, competing priorities, and shifting timelines, with the ability to keep projects moving without becoming a bottleneck.
  • Demonstrate clear communication skills, capable of explaining infrastructure complexity in plain language for leadership and translating business priorities into technical requirements for engineers.
  • Possess a minimum of 4 years of experience in relevant roles involving video, media systems, or related technical fields (implied by the need for real technical depth and experience managing complex programs).
